Rod Tate was born on November 23, 1939 in Carbon Hill, AL where he spent the first 18 years of his life.  He then joined the Navy where he would end up being stationed in Corpus Christi, TX.  That is where he would meet and marry Mimi Shanley.  Their marriage lasted three months short of 60 years.  Three children came along and a house filled with love and laughter.  After the Navy, Rod worked for Xerox for a short time before receiving the call to preach.  He became a preacher and that would be his calling for the next 50 plus years.  In that time, he and Mimi were foster parents to close to 20 children and also worked closely with Children Homes associated with churches of Christ.  He would also teach and administratively lead Bible colleges associated with the church, inspiring dozens of young men to preach the gospel as he did.  Many owe a great debt to a great man of God.
